It isn't going to be a simple face lift renovation. The east and wsidelines side are in bad shape. Hell the lower decks were built in the late 1920's.

They will likely build the south endzone first in year one, then completely demolish and rebuild the student side (east side) and move the students to the south endzone in year two. Year three will be the former student side (west) rebuild with either the students or former students in the south endzone. The northern endzone is fairly new and it will likely only need a new facade to match whatever is built on the other sides and a little updating that can be done after one of the seasons.

It will be pretty much a brand new stadium except for the north endzone.
